ElMacaco

ElMacaco

Views:
49,744
Subscribers:
848
Videos:
500
Duration:
1:08:04:23
United States
United States

ElMacaco is an American YouTube channel which has 848 subscribers. His content totals more than 49.74 thousand views views across 500 videos.

Created on ● Channel Link: https://www.youtube.com/channel/UC1ZBCkhK3JzYNzWSkVZxsIA